Bill overview
This bill amends the rules governing the West Virginia Hope Scholarship Board. It changes the board’s membership to include a Director of the Herbert Henderson Office of Minority Affairs and specifies that three board members must be parents of Hope Scholarship students, with certain geographic and educational option representation requirements. The bill also clarifies term lengths, compensation for expenses, and the roles of the State Treasurer and State Superintendent of Schools in supporting the board’s operations.
